ExternalFontCache
Inheritance: java.lang.Object
public class ExternalFontCache
استخدم هذه الفئة للحصول على تغليف الخط في صيغة يتم قبولها من قبل Device.
المنشئات
| منشئ | الوصف |
|---|---|
| ExternalFontCache() |
الحقول
| حقل | الوصف |
|---|---|
| DEFAULT_SIZE | حجم الخط الافتراضي. |
| DEFAULT_STYLE | نمط الخط الافتراضي. |
الطرق
ExternalFontCache()
public ExternalFontCache()
DEFAULT_SIZE
public static final float DEFAULT_SIZE
حجم الخط الافتراضي.
DEFAULT_STYLE
public static final int DEFAULT_STYLE
نمط الخط الافتراضي.
FetchTrFont(String familyName)
public DrFont FetchTrFont(String familyName)
يجلب DrFont حسب اسم عائلة الخط، الحجم الافتراضي (1) والنمط الافتراضي (PLAIN).
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
FetchTrFont(String familyName, int style)
public DrFont FetchTrFont(String familyName, int style)
يجلب DrFont حسب اسم عائلة الخط، الحجم الافتراضي (1) والنمط.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| نمط | int | نمط الخط.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
equals(Object arg0)
public boolean equals(Object arg0)
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| arg0 | java.lang.Object |
Returns: boolean
fetchDrFont(String familyName, float sizePoints, int style)
public static DrFont fetchDrFont(String familyName, float sizePoints, int style)
يجلب DrFont حسب اسم عائلة الخط، الحجم والنمط.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| sizePoints | float | حجم الخط بالنقاط (نقطة واحدة هي 1/72 من البوصة). |
| نمط | int | نمط الخط.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
fetchDrFont(String familyName, float sizePoints, int style, int fontCapitals)
public DrFont fetchDrFont(String familyName, float sizePoints, int style, int fontCapitals)
يجلب DrFont حسب اسم عائلة الخط، الحجم، النمط وحروف الخط الكبيرة.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| sizePoints | float | حجم الخط بالنقاط (نقطة واحدة هي 1/72 من البوصة). |
| نمط | int | نمط الخط. |
| fontCapitals | int | حروف الخط الكبيرة.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
fetchDrFont(String familyName, float sizePoints, int style, String altFamilyName)
public DrFont fetchDrFont(String familyName, float sizePoints, int style, String altFamilyName)
يجلب DrFont حسب اسم عائلة الخط، الحجم، النمط واسم عائلة الخط البديل.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| sizePoints | float | حجم الخط بالنقاط (نقطة واحدة هي 1/72 من البوصة). |
| نمط | int | نمط الخط. |
| altFamilyName | java.lang.String | اسم عائلة الخط البديلة.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
fetchDrFont(String familyName, float sizePoints, int style, String altFamilyName, int fontCapitals)
public DrFont fetchDrFont(String familyName, float sizePoints, int style, String altFamilyName, int fontCapitals)
يجلب DrFont حسب اسم عائلة الخط، الحجم، النمط، حروف الخط الكبيرة واسم عائلة الخط البديل.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| sizePoints | float | حجم الخط بالنقاط (نقطة واحدة هي 1/72 من البوصة). |
| نمط | int | نمط الخط. |
| altFamilyName | java.lang.String | اسم عائلة الخط البديلة. |
| fontCapitals | int | حروف الخط الكبيرة. |
Returns: com.aspose.foundation.drawing.DrFont - DrFont.
fetchTTFont(String familyName, int style, String altFamilyName)
public TTFont fetchTTFont(String familyName, int style, String altFamilyName)
يجلب TTFont حسب اسم عائلة الخط، النمط واسم عائلة الخط البديل.
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| familyName | java.lang.String | اسم عائلة الخط. |
| نمط | int | نمط الخط. |
| altFamilyName | java.lang.String | اسم عائلة الخط البديلة. |
Returns: com.aspose.foundation.truetype.TTFont - TTFont.
getClass()
public final native Class<?> getClass()
Returns: java.lang.Class
hashCode()
public native int hashCode()
Returns: int
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
setAdditionalFontsFolders(String[] additionalFontFolders)
public static void setAdditionalFontsFolders(String[] additionalFontFolders)
يحدد مجلدات الخطوط الإضافية. مجلدات الخطوط التي يستخدمها نظام التشغيل تُستخدم بواسطة ذاكرة التخزين المؤقت للخطوط الخارجية بشكل افتراضي. لا توجد حاجة لتحديدها،
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| additionalFontFolders | java.lang.String[] | مصفوفة من مجلدات الخطوط الإضافية. |
toString()
public String toString()
Returns: java.lang.String
wait()
public final void wait()
wait(long arg0)
public final native void wait(long arg0)
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
Parameters:
| معامل | نوع | الوصف |
|---|---|---|
| arg0 | long | |
| arg1 | int |